Head to head by decade

Decade Europe (WHO regions) Kyrgyzstan Difference Ahead
1950s 13,554 68.75 13,485 Europe (WHO regions)
1960s 13,627 89.79 13,538 Europe (WHO regions)
1970s 13,003 104.09 12,899 Europe (WHO regions)
1980s 13,177 127.27 13,050 Europe (WHO regions)
1990s 11,089 122.49 10,967 Europe (WHO regions)
2000s 10,515 118.61 10,396 Europe (WHO regions)
2010s 11,230 153.56 11,077 Europe (WHO regions)
2020s 9,616 149.12 9,467 Europe (WHO regions)
2030s 9,262 154.4 9,107 Europe (WHO regions)
2040s 9,639 163.17 9,476 Europe (WHO regions)
2050s 8,894 154 8,740 Europe (WHO regions)
2060s 8,399 150.39 8,249 Europe (WHO regions)
2070s 8,413 147.13 8,266 Europe (WHO regions)
2080s 8,020 138.01 7,882 Europe (WHO regions)
2090s 7,564 131.23 7,432 Europe (WHO regions)
2100s 7,459 127.91 7,331 Europe (WHO regions)

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
